Clarify Strategic Priorities Before Tool Assessment

A 2024 EdTech Research Institute report noted that 63% of K12 education operations leaders struggle to align technology investments with strategic goals. Before evaluating vendors or platforms, define your core objectives clearly: Is the goal expanding digital content delivery? Improving student engagement analytics? Streamlining administrative workflows?

For example, a mid-sized test-prep company targeting AP course preparation set a priority to reduce manual grading time by 25%. This focus led them to prioritize assessment automation tools over broader LMS platforms. Without this upfront prioritization, pilot rollouts risk resource drain and diluted impact.

The downside is that overly narrow priorities could cause missed opportunities in adjacent operational improvements. Balance focus with periodic reevaluation every 6-12 months.

Conduct a Cost-Benefit Analysis Using Real Usage Data

Budget constraints require a rigorous cost-benefit approach grounded in actual usage metrics. Operations teams should gather data on current platform utilization, such as student logins, active hours, features adopted, and helpdesk tickets.

A 2023 K12 Test-Prep Operations Survey found that organizations reduced software spend by an average of 18% after identifying underused licensed features and renegotiating contracts accordingly. For instance, one company cut a $120K annual software license to $85K by scaling back concurrent user licenses and eliminating low-value modules.

Combining cost data with impact metrics (e.g., conversion rates increase of 6% after adopting adaptive practice test tech) sharpens ROI projections. However, quality data can be incomplete or inconsistent in many K12 operations, especially when multiple vendors don’t integrate well. Initial investments in data cleanup may be necessary.

Prioritize Open-Source and Freemium Alternatives with Support Options

Free or freemium tools now play a larger role in education technology stacks, especially for budget-conscious organizations. In 2024, 48% of K12 test-prep providers reported integrating open-source LMS platforms or assessment tools as part of a phased transition strategy.

A real-world example: One test-prep provider piloted Moodle, an open-source LMS, coupled with H5P interactive content tools to replace a proprietary system costing $15 per student/month. Within nine months, they reduced licensing costs by 60% while maintaining content delivery quality.

Yet, open-source adoption requires internal technical capability or reliable external partners for maintenance and customizations. The total cost of ownership depends on in-house staff time and training infrastructure, which can be underestimated.

Additionally, freemium products may limit advanced features or scale, potentially leading to incremental costs as user base grows.

Implement Phased Rollouts to Manage Risk and Budget

Phasing technology deployment limits upfront capital expenditures and operational disruption. The 2023 K12 EdOps Benchmark indicated that phased rollouts reduced project overruns by 32% compared to all-at-once deployments.

For example, a test-prep company first piloted a new student progress analytics dashboard with a single high school client over one academic term. They measured a 10% increase in course completion rates and fewer support requests before scaling to other clients.

Phased approaches allow iterative feedback loops—using tools such as Zigpoll, SurveyMonkey, or Qualtrics—to capture user experience and identify bugs in manageable segments.

Nevertheless, phased rollouts extend timelines and require disciplined project management to avoid scope creep. In fast-moving markets, slower pace risks competitor catch-up.

Emphasize Integration Capabilities to Reduce Duplication

Fragmented technology stacks inflate costs through redundant features and complex maintenance. Evaluating integration readiness is essential to ensure new tools connect with existing student information systems (SIS), CRM platforms, or content repositories.

A 2023 Forrester analysis found that K12 test-prep providers with well-integrated tech stacks reduced total software-associated operational costs by 22% compared to peers with siloed systems.

Consider vendors supporting standards like LTI (Learning Tools Interoperability) or REST APIs. For instance, a test-prep business integrated its adaptive assessment engine with its LMS and CRM, automating student progress reporting and follow-up communications, leading to a 7% lift in enrollment conversions.

Limitation: Integration complexity often emerges during implementation, requiring technical resources and sometimes custom development, potentially eroding initial cost savings.

Use Board-Level Metrics to Guide Technology Decisions

C-suite executives and boards require clear, quantifiable metrics to evaluate technology investments. Metrics aligned to strategic priorities facilitate resource allocation and help communicate value to stakeholders.

Typical K12 test-prep metrics include:

  • Student engagement rate (e.g., daily active users over enrolled students)
  • Student performance improvement (e.g., average score increase on standardized practice tests)
  • Cost per enrolled student or per test completed
  • Time saved in administrative processes (grading, onboarding)

A 2024 Industry Pulse survey showed that organizations tracking cost per student alongside engagement saw 13% higher ROI from technology projects.

Data visualization dashboards aggregating these metrics should be accessible to board members. These help avoid decisions based on anecdotal evidence or vendor promises alone.

However, boards may prioritize short-term financial metrics over longer-term learner outcomes, requiring balanced reporting and education.


Prioritization Advice for Budget-Constrained Operations

Start with defining strategic priorities clearly to avoid scattershot investments. Next, collect and analyze current usage and cost data to understand baseline spending and impact.

Pilot open-source or freemium tools in controlled phases, tracking core board-level metrics for objective evaluations. Simultaneously, assess integration possibilities to reduce stack complexity and operational overhead.

Finally, maintain transparent, data-driven communication with your board throughout, ensuring technology decisions tie back to student outcomes and efficiency improvements.

This incremental, data-informed approach enables doing more with less—supporting sustainable growth in a financially constrained K12 test-prep environment.
